Difference between revisions of "Team:Rice/Model"

Line 34: Line 34:
 
         #topbox {
 
         #topbox {
 
             height: 30vh;
 
             height: 30vh;
             background-image: url(https://static.igem.org/mediawiki/2019/a/a9/T--Rice--Modeling.svg);
+
             background-image: url(https://static.igem.org/mediawiki/2019/a/a9/T--Rice--Modeling.svg));
 
             background-size: cover;
 
             background-size: cover;
 
             background-position: 50% 50%;
 
             background-position: 50% 50%;
Line 66: Line 66:
 
         .container {
 
         .container {
 
             background-color: white !important;
 
             background-color: white !important;
        }
 
 
        /* Create two equal columns that floats next to each other */
 
        .column {
 
            float: left;
 
            width: 50%;
 
            padding: 10px;
 
        }
 
 
        /* Clear floats after the columns */
 
        .row:after {
 
            content: "";
 
            display: table;
 
            clear: both;
 
 
 
         }
 
         }
  
Line 107: Line 92:
 
             font-size: 30px !important;
 
             font-size: 30px !important;
 
             text-align: center;
 
             text-align: center;
 +
            padding: 10px !important;
 
         }
 
         }
  
 
         body {
 
         body {
 
             margin: 0;
 
             margin: 0;
             background-color: #1f9ec1 !important;
+
             background-color: #fff !important;
 
         }
 
         }
  
         .column {
+
         ol {
            columns: 50vw 2;
+
            font-size: 20px !important;
 +
            font-family: raleway !important;
 +
        }
 +
 
 +
        li {
 +
            font-size: 20px !important;
 +
            font-family: raleway !important;
 +
        }
 +
 
 +
        @media screen and (orientation: portrait) {
 +
            .column {
 +
                width: 100%;
 +
            }
 
         }
 
         }
 
     </style>
 
     </style>
Line 124: Line 122:
 
         <h1></h1>
 
         <h1></h1>
 
     </div>
 
     </div>
 +
    <br />
  
 
     <div class="container">
 
     <div class="container">
         <div class="column">
+
 
 +
         <div class="column" style="background-color: #d2e8c5!important; height: 65vh;">
 +
            <h2>Basis for a Genetic Algorithm</h2>
 
             <p>
 
             <p>
 
                 Lorem ipsum dolor sit amet, consectetur adipiscing elit. Sed id porta lacus. Proin vel urna nec ex
 
                 Lorem ipsum dolor sit amet, consectetur adipiscing elit. Sed id porta lacus. Proin vel urna nec ex
Line 134: Line 135:
 
                 et porttitor sollicitudin. In hac habitasse platea dictumst.
 
                 et porttitor sollicitudin. In hac habitasse platea dictumst.
 
             </p>
 
             </p>
 +
        </div>
 +
        <div class="column" style="background-color: #ffffff!important; height: 65vh;">
 
             <img class="img-responsive" style="width:100%; padding:10px;"
 
             <img class="img-responsive" style="width:100%; padding:10px;"
 
                 src="https://static.igem.org/mediawiki/2019/1/18/T--Rice--basic_heat_response.png" />
 
                 src="https://static.igem.org/mediawiki/2019/1/18/T--Rice--basic_heat_response.png" />
 
         </div>
 
         </div>
    </div>
+
        <div class="row" style="background-color:#9bc4cf!important; padding-top: 5vh;">
 +
            <h2>Percentage base pair optimization algorithm</h2>
 +
            <ol>
 +
                <li>
 +
                    <p>
 +
                        For each base of the complement of the context containing the RBS, create three other
 +
                        permutations which have that base mutated. All of these permutations combined form the initial
 +
                        population. The baseline is defined as the full sequence containing the context before the
 +
                        variable region, the variable region which is the complement of the RBS-containing context, and
 +
                        the RBS-containing context.
 +
                    </p>
 +
                </li>
 +
                <li>
 +
                    <p>
 +
                        Calculate the base pairing probabilities at the two given temperatures for each test sequence
 +
                        using the NuPack command <code>pairs -T TEMP -pseudo -material rna sequencename.</code>
 +
                    </p>
 +
                </li>
 +
                <li>
 +
                    <p>
 +
                        The output of the command consists in part of a list of every base and the base(s) which it has
 +
                        a > 0.001 probability of base pairing with by position number. Find the base pairings where one
 +
                        of the bases is in the RBS-containing region and add up the probabilities corresponding to that
 +
                        base pairing. The nature of this NuPack command should prevent duplicates. Then, subtract the
 +
                        probability that these bases are unpaired.
 +
                    </p>
 +
                </li>
 +
                <li>
 +
                    <p>
 +
                        Subtract the number of base pairings at 30°C from the number of base pairings at 25°C. We want
 +
                        to maximize the number of RBS-base pairings that disappear as the temperature increases from
 +
                        25°C to 30°C (for reference, the command I use for the minimum free energy calculation is
 +
                        <code>mfe -T TEMP -pseudo -material rna sequencename</code>)
 +
                    </p>
 +
                </li>
 +
                <li>
 +
                    <p>
 +
                        Using the library DEAP, select 50 individuals through the tournament selection method.
 +
                    </p>
 +
                </li>
 +
            </ol>
 +
        </div>
  
 +
    </div>
 
</body>
 
</body>
  
 
</html>
 
</html>
{{Rice/footer}}
 

Revision as of 21:17, 28 September 2019


Basis for a Genetic Algorithm

Lorem ipsum dolor sit amet, consectetur adipiscing elit. Sed id porta lacus. Proin vel urna nec ex rhoncus tristique at ut felis. Integer pharetra ipsum sapien, a bibendum nisi facilisis egestas. Nam molestie urna quis porttitor vulputate. Cras nibh leo, fringilla eget luctus et, rutrum ut risus. Aliquam finibus nulla eu nunc luctus vulputate. Duis euismod pellentesque dictum. Curabitur blandit diam et porttitor sollicitudin. In hac habitasse platea dictumst.

Percentage base pair optimization algorithm

  1. For each base of the complement of the context containing the RBS, create three other permutations which have that base mutated. All of these permutations combined form the initial population. The baseline is defined as the full sequence containing the context before the variable region, the variable region which is the complement of the RBS-containing context, and the RBS-containing context.

  2. Calculate the base pairing probabilities at the two given temperatures for each test sequence using the NuPack command pairs -T TEMP -pseudo -material rna sequencename.

  3. The output of the command consists in part of a list of every base and the base(s) which it has a > 0.001 probability of base pairing with by position number. Find the base pairings where one of the bases is in the RBS-containing region and add up the probabilities corresponding to that base pairing. The nature of this NuPack command should prevent duplicates. Then, subtract the probability that these bases are unpaired.

  4. Subtract the number of base pairings at 30°C from the number of base pairings at 25°C. We want to maximize the number of RBS-base pairings that disappear as the temperature increases from 25°C to 30°C (for reference, the command I use for the minimum free energy calculation is mfe -T TEMP -pseudo -material rna sequencename)

  5. Using the library DEAP, select 50 individuals through the tournament selection method.